Embarkation: Marsh Harbour at 6 pm.
Disembarkation: Marsh Harbour at 9 am.
Day 1 – Saturday: Marsh Harbour.
Welcome aboard at 17:00 in the Conch Inn & Marina, Marsh Harbour. After a safety briefing and introduction to the week ahead, settle in for dinner and your first night on board.
Day 2 – Sunday: Marsh Harbour → Guana Cay
We set sail at 09:00, heading toward Fisher’s Bay (Guana Cay, 7 nm – 1 hr). Spend the day exploring this charming island—enjoy local cocktails and live music at Grabber’s Bar & Grill, swim on the ocean side, or simply relax on the beach. In the afternoon, a short sail brings us to Baker’s Bay for snorkeling, kayaking, and paddleboarding. Overnight anchorage.
Day 3 – Monday: Manjack Cay → Green Turtle Cay.
Depart Baker’s Bay at 09:00, sailing north through the Whale Cay Passage to Manjack Cay (18 nm – 2.5 hrs). Discover pristine beaches, snorkel in the Marine National Park, feed friendly stingrays, or follow scenic trails to the ocean side. Later, continue to Coco Bay (Green Turtle Cay, 3 nm – 30 min) for a peaceful overnight anchorage.
Day 4 – Tuesday: Green Turtle Cay → Noname Cay.
Enjoy a relaxing morning at Coco Bay—ideal for snorkeling and swimming with stingrays and turtles. Then sail to New Plymouth (3 nm – 30 min) to explore Green Turtle Cay’s charming settlement, visiting landmarks like the Memorial Sculpture Garden and local art galleries. In the afternoon, cruise to Noname Cay to meet the famous Bahamas swimming pigs and enjoy another night at anchor.
Day 5 – Wednesday: Scotland Cay & Fowl Cay.
Sail south at 09:00 to Crawl Bight (Guana Cay, 24 nm – 3.5 hrs). Drop anchor near a stunning sandbar north of Scotland Cay—perfect for swimming and visiting the nearby turtle sanctuary. Continue to Fowl Cay (30 min) for exceptional snorkeling in the Marine National Park. Overnight anchorage.
Day 6 – Thursday: Hopetown – Elbow Cay.
Depart at 09:00 for Hopetown Harbour (Elbow Cay, 11 nm – 1.5 hrs). Wander through this postcard-perfect village, visit the Wyannie Malone Historical Museum, and admire the famous candy-striped lighthouse. Relax on the pink-sand beaches before anchoring overnight.
Day 7 – Friday: Tahiti Beach & Man-O-War Cay.
Sail at 09:00 toward Tahiti Beach (3 nm – 30 min), a beautiful sandbar with turquoise water and a floating bar, Thirsty Cuda. In the afternoon, continue to Man-O-War Cay (5 nm – 45 min), anchoring near Old Scopley’s Rock. Enjoy snorkeling, kayaking, or exploring the quiet settlement. Stop at Dip & Sip for ice cream or browse handmade canvas goods at the local Sail Shop.
Day 8 – Saturday: Return to Marsh Harbour.
Early departure at 08:00 for Conch Inn Marina, arriving at 10:00 for disembarkation.
Note: Itinerary may be subject to change due to weather or operational considerations.
